1989 Ford Taurus SHO
Terminator 3: Rise of the Machines (2003)
jc8825 USIt is a first gen SHO, but if you look at the front it appears that there is no engine in the car since the front sits up higher than it should, even being in a rear collision. What is in the back window? Also, further into the chase there is another SHO parked on the side of the street that get flipped and crushed when the crane is knocking over power poles. I just don't know why they picked SHOs to wreck. The SHOs are rare. They would have had to seek out SHOs specially whereas regular first gen Tauruses would have been easy to get a hold of.

Look at the B-pillars on the car and you will notice that they are painted body color. The B-pillars should be black. This means the car has been re-painted. It may have been a salvage car (due to the visible rear damage before the first impact) that they painted and wrecked for the movie. The initial damage seems minor, but due to the entire trunk leaning to one side, that is indicative of the car's unibody damage which cannot be repaired.
